Output acfa5511d59bb9ec166483174603a8d4d560c8d9cbd12eef21d59fe4d4952d90:11

value
25569453
script pubkey
OP_0 OP_PUSHBYTES_32 d73b141841523b3332d79864133482d9934017426010337072ddcd53e7ba0208
address
bc1q6ua3gxzp2ganxvkhnpjpxdyzmxf5q96zvqgrxurjmhx48ea6qgyqpqwmv9
transaction
acfa5511d59bb9ec166483174603a8d4d560c8d9cbd12eef21d59fe4d4952d90
confirmations
269870
spent
true